Null controllability and finite-time stabilization in minimal time of one-dimensional first-order linear hyperbolic systems
arXiv:2010.15664
Abstract
The goal of this article is to present the minimal time needed for the null controllability and finite-time stabilization of one-dimensional first-order linear hyperbolic systems. The main technical point is to show that we cannot obtain a better time. The proof combines the backstepping method with the Titchmarsh convolution theorem.
